Ron and Elizabeth Carpol
As a Public Defender, Ron defended a burglar who broke into the Santa Monica residence of a fashion model, stealing thousands of dollars worth of the victim’s clothing. Five months after the hostile trial and jailing of the burglar, Ron married the model and he and Elizabeth have been married for over 38 years. They have four children and five grandchildren and live in a suburb of Los Angeles.
Background Highlights
- Since 1967, Admitted to practice in California and (Federal) U.S. District Court, Central District of California
- Member State Bar of California, Criminal Law Section and Family Law Section
- Member Los Angeles County Bar Association, Criminal Law Section and Family Law Section
- Los Angeles County Deputy District Attorney for 11 years where he filed and prosecuted thousands of
felony and misdemeanor cases
- Organized Crime Division where he prosecuted the Black Panthers and the Mexican Mafia
- Head of Obscenity and Pornography Division where he lost every case for a year since Linda Lovelace and Deep Throat set the community standards for freedom of expression
- Head of the Malibu District Attorney’s Office where he was in charge of filing and prosecuting thousands of criminal cases
- Former Law Professor
- Former Judge Pro Tem, Los Angeles Superior Court
- Former Los Angeles County Deputy Court Clerk
- Graduate of University of Southern California
- Former Los Angeles Unified School District Elementary School Teacher (5th grade)
- Honorable Discharge from the U.S. Navy
